17 June 2020Stop of the circular with which, on 21 March last, reports were made of cases of detainees who, due to diseases or age, were at greater risk in the case of contagion from coronavirus, believed to be the basis of release, also of inmates in high security and 41 bis, which occurred in the past few weeks. It is the decision taken by the leaders of the Dap with a note, which bears yesterday's date, sent to the regional administrators of the penitentiary administration. A document, the one signed by Bernardo Petralia and his deputy Roberto Tartaglia, which recalls the " constant decrease "cases of contagion in prison - yesterday's figure speaks of 66 positives on a prison population of about 53 thousand people - the protocols and legislative measures adopted to contain Covid risk, while reiterating the need for" monitoring "of health detainees, especially the most critical situations.

The new measure of the Dap arrived in the same hours in which the controversy about the release from prison and the circular of March 21st returned to the center of the investigation launched by the Parliamentary Anti-Mafia Commission which yesterday summoned Giulio Romano, former prison inmate and treatment of the Dap - he resigned in the following weeks following, he explained himself, of the "clamor about release" and waiting to return to the role of the general prosecutor of the Cassation - who said that on the circular he had had "the assent "of the then chief Dap Francesco Basentini (who left the post after the controversy) and that the same Guardasigilli Alfonso Bonafede, on a date after March 26, had expressed, during a videoconference, his" appreciation ". 

Romano: "Zagaria released from my office, a serious mistake"
Romano, in his hearing yesterday, also retraced, in particular, the case of Pasquale Zagaria, the Casalesi boss who, from 41 bis, obtained home detention for related reasons to his health and risk Covid: "It was a serious mistake by my office," said Romano, speaking of a problem in the email communication between the Dap and the Sassari surveillance judges. Unlike other bosses, Zagaria did not return to his cell due to the effects of the 'anti-imprisonment' dictated by Bonafede and on which the Senate is called today to cast a vote of confidence and the CSM will give its opinion: the proceedings they concern him, in fact, were sent to the Consulta for the examination of the constitutionality of the decree.

Romano's declarations have left the president of the Antimafia Commission Nicola Morra "amazed", who has already scheduled for tonight the continuation of the hearing of the former director Dap. In Antimafia, Sebastiano Ardita is expected this afternoon, toga of the CSM and in the past director of prisoners and treatment of the prison administration, while tomorrow Nino Di Matteo will be heard, ex pm of the negotiation process and now toga at Palazzo dei Marescialli, who is He was the protagonist, at the beginning of May, of a 'clash' on live TV with the minister Bonafede on his non-appointment to lead the Dap in June 2018, when the choice of the Guardasigilli eventually fell on Basentini.

Catello Maresca: "Well Dap, but more courage was needed"
The Dap circular of 21 March last "should not be suspended, it should be canceled, in respect of the relatives of the victims of the mafia". The deputy attorney general of Naples, Catello Maresca, immediately extremely critical with a measure that in fact allowed the release of prisoners at 41 bis or in high security because they were considered at risk of complications in the event of contagion from Covid 19. The suspension "is a first step "to correct the shot," but you had to be more courageous ".

"It was necessary to distance oneself from that provision - he explains - also by affirming a principle opposite to what was contained therein, and that is that the Dap was able to manage the Covid emergency". "I do not explain why it was not done - adds Maresca - since this note is signed by the heads of the department, the chief and the deputy chief. It is as if the mountain had given birth to a mouse. I do not understand the reason to suspend the effectiveness of the note of March 21 as if it were no longer useful, creating the misunderstanding that it is a measure to be resumed or reapplied if there is a coronavirus emergency again ". "However - he concludes - finally, albeit in a non-explicit form, there is the finding that that note was wrong, two and a half months after its issue".
